That’s generally always been a tool for pros, but the ROLL R1 Percussion ($129) now makes deep muscle massage available to everyone to do at home.



Developed with feedback from elite and professional athletes, the R1 Percussion was designed to be compact, powerful, quiet, efficient and durable.
Unlike your docs massager, the R1 Percussion is cordless and USB rechargable, and delivers up to 7 hours of usage on a charge that takes just 3 hours.
The body of the R1 is made with aircraft-grade aluminum. While not heavy by any means, it feels solid in the hand and allows you to really put your body weight into it to get the most effect.
Depending on the location and type of ache, the four heads supplied with the R1 give you all the options to need to get at your aches and pains, but I have also found that the R1 can help build some muscle tone to some degree as well.
While the R1 offers 4 speeds (1800rpm, 2200rpm, 2600rpm, 3200rpm), I personally have never gone above the 2200rpm level and have still found it to be effective.
